Kyoto’s mission: Empower industries with renewable thermal energy. 

At Kyoto Group, we are on a mission to make renewable energy the easy choice for industries. 

Our innovative thermal battery technology enables industries to replace fossil fuels with clean electricity for heat production - without compromising efficiency, stability, or cost. Since industrial heat accounts for nearly half of global energy consumption, our solutions are crucial in driving a sustainable transition.

Kyoto Group is named after the Kyoto Protocol, an international treaty to reduce greenhouse gas emissions to combat climate change. The Protocol represents a significant step in global efforts to address climate change, setting the stage for future agreements like the Paris Agreement. About us

Kyoto Group

Founded in 2016, Kyoto is a Norwegian company dedicated to harnessing the vast potential of variable renewable energy sources, such as solar and wind power. Our mission is to leverage this clean energy to reduce the CO2 emissions associated with industrial thermal loads significantly. We are pioneering the integration of thermal sales and flexibility into a single product, positioning Kyoto as a competitive leader in the thermal industry. Our unique approach allows us to offer both heat sales and flexibility solutions, making a sustainable future more attainable.

Market & Products

Kyoto's core strategy involves selling and operating Heatcube thermal batteries, which enable industrial consumption of low-cost heat derived from surplus solar and wind energy (i.e., during periods of low-priced electricity). Additionally, Kyoto operates an Energy Management System—a remote-control solution that optimises renewable energy consumption for cost efficiency and carbon neutrality. Our dual focus is to provide end-users with an affordable, carbon-neutral heat product while offering balancing services and flexibility solutions to power producers and grid operators.
